Как софтверные разработки осуществляют тестирование соответствия

Как софтверные разработки осуществляют тестирование соответствия

Актуальная разработка программного обеспечения немыслима без системной системы проверки надежности. Любой сутки огромное количество клиентов взаимодействуют с различными сервисами, веб-сервисами и техническими продуктами, ожидая от них надежной деятельности, безопасности и соответствия заявленному функционалу. Методология обеспечения стандартов программных продуктов составляет собой многоуровневую структуру контроля, анализа и надзора, которая сопровождает решение на всех стадиях его развития.

Что именно определяют надежностью в цифровых продуктах

Стандарт программного обеспечения Драгон мани устанавливается множеством характеристик, которые в совокупности определяют пользовательский взаимодействие и технологическую устойчивость продукта. Возможности составляет ключевым параметром – приложение должна реализовывать все объявленные функции в согласии с технологическими требованиями и надеждами клиентов.

Устойчивость технического решения демонстрируется в его умении действовать без ошибок в разнообразных обстоятельствах применения. Это охватывает стабильность к неожиданным параметрам, корректную управление ошибочных ситуаций и способность возвращаться после краткосрочных сбоев. Быстродействие показывает скорость выполнения действий, длительность ответа программы на потребительские действия и эффективность задействования системных возможностей.

Удобство использования показывает, как логичным и удобным является работа с приложением для конечных пользователей. Сюда включаются эргономичность интерфейса Драгон мани казино, логичность перемещения, возможность для граждан с специальными потребностями и всеобщая легкость изучения опций.

Сопровождаемость программного программирования влияет на способность его последующего совершенствования и обслуживания. Профессионально написанный код призван быть читаемым, структурированным, детально оформленным и упорядоченным таким образом, чтобы другие разработчики могли просто в нем понять и включить необходимые модификации.

Каким образом проверяют, что всё работает по условиям

Проверка соответствия цифрового решения требованиям начинается с скрупулезного анализа спецификаций и операционных требований. Отдел контроля формирует детальные проверки, которые охватывают все указанные в документации варианты использования приложения Dragon Money. Каждый случай включает определенные шаги для воспроизведения, ожидаемые результаты и критерии успешного завершения проверки.

Матрица трассируемости требований содействует проверить, что любое условие включено релевантными тестами, а любой проверка связан с конкретным условием. Это позволяет предотвратить случаев, когда важная функциональность становится нетестированной или когда расходуется ресурс на контроль мнимых спецификаций.

Финальное испытание выполняется с участием заказчиков или участников департаментов, которые максимально полно представляют, как система призвана действовать в действительных ситуациях. Они тестируют не только системную корректность воплощения, но и соответствие деловым операциям и потребительским ожиданиям.

Регрессионное проверка подтверждает, что недавние корректировки в программе не сломали ранее функционировавший возможности. После любого обновления или исправления багов стартует группа проверок, контролирующих главные возможности приложения.

Почему контроль начинается еще до написания программы

Актуальный метод к обеспечению надежности предполагает деятельное привлечение экспертов по проверке на самых ранних стадиях проекта:

  • Изучение требований позволяет выявить погрешности, несоответствия и упущения в технологических условиях до начала разработки.
  • Создание проверочных случаев содействует лучше осмыслить ожидаемое функционирование системы и детализировать нюансы выполнения.
  • Формирование проверочных данных и проверочной базы сберегает время на последующих этапах.
  • Планирование методологии контроля выявляет необходимые средства и сроки для надежной проверки.
  • Разработка автоматизированных тестов может инициироваться синхронно с разработкой главного скрипта.

Подобный метод, признанный как “перенос влево” в тестировании, значительно снижает цену исправления ошибок, поскольку их обнаружение и устранение на первоначальных фазах нуждается минимальных расходов периода и ресурсов. Кроме того, раннее включение экспертов в ход содействует формированию совместного восприятия проекта у целой коллектива программирования Драгон мани.

Которые типы контроля применяют: ручным способом и автоматически

Человеческое испытание продолжает быть необходимым способом для контроля клиентского взаимодействия, исследовательского проверки и проверки многоуровневых деловых случаев. Тестировщики исполняют роль конечных клиентов, работая с системой через графический взаимодействие и оценивая комфорт эксплуатации, понятность деятельности и совместимость ожиданиям.

Экспериментальное тестирование позволяет выявить внезапные ошибки и неполадки, которые не были предусмотрены в стандартных проверках. Квалифицированные эксперты используют свое знание направления и техническую чутье для нахождения возможных уязвимостей в приложении.

Механизированное испытание результативно для контроля циклических вариантов, возвратного тестирования и проверки больших количеств данных. Программные тесты могут исполняться непрерывно, не предполагают участия человека и предоставляют надежные выводы проверки.

Единичное проверка тестирует изолированные компоненты программы Dragon Money в изоляции от другой структуры. Разработчики разрабатывают проверки для своего программирования, которые запускаются при каждом изменении и способствуют быстро находить проблемы на уровне индивидуальных функций или групп.

Интеграционное проверка фокусируется на контроле связи между различными компонентами и компонентами программы. Оно способствует выявить неполадки в взаимодействиях, пересылке данных между частями и совокупной построении продукта.

Какими методами находят баги на разных фазах разработки

На фазе проектирования и проектирования неточности выявляются через ревью технологических условий, анализ конструкционных решений и моделирование клиентских случаев. Эксперты отличающихся направлений изучают материалы, выявляют возможные сложности и предлагают оптимизации до инициирования интенсивной разработки.

Во момент написания программы кодеры используют неподвижный исследование кода, который программно тестирует приложение Драгон мани на соответствие нормам кодирования, возможные проблемы секьюрности и стандартные ошибки кодирования. Актуальные объединенные платформы программирования включают утилиты, которые отмечают сложности непосредственно в процессе разработки кода.

Код-ревью представляет собой методологию коллективной анализа программы разработчиками. Товарищи изучают разработанный программу с точки зрения понятности работы, совместимости стандартам команды, потенциальных проблем эффективности и возможностей для усовершенствования. Этот деятельность не только помогает выявить баги, но и помогает передаче знаниями в группе.

Динамическое испытание выполняется на работающей программе и содержит различные виды функционального и дополнительного тестирования. Тестировщики стартуют систему с разнообразными параметрами, проверяют поведение в предельных ситуациях и анализируют выводы реализации.

Почему критично контролировать безопасность и охрану данных

Секьюрность технических разработок Dragon Money оказывается критически важным элементом стандарта в период цифровизации и возрастающих киберугроз. Нарушения безопасности могут вызвать не только к экономическим ущербу, но и к серьезному вреду престижу организации, потере веры заказчиков и правовым последствиям.

Проверка защищенности включает тестирование идентификации и авторизации клиентов, обороны от ключевых разновидностей угроз, подобно вставки кода, XSS и фальсификация междоменных запросов. Специалисты по секьюрности исследуют построение системы с точки зрения вероятных рисков и тестируют результативность внедренных защитных систем.

Оборона персональных сведений требует специального концентрации в связи с повышением строгости законодательства в области приватности. Приложения призваны корректно работать, хранить и транспортировать чувствительную сведения, обеспечивать способность удаления данных по просьбе клиентов и выполнять принципы минимизации получения информации.

Шифровальная охрана информации Драгон мани казино проверяется на вопрос применения актуальных методов шифрования, корректной воплощения стандартов безопасности и правильного управления паролями. Проблемные зоны в защите могут сделать всю механизм обороны бесполезной.

Как тестируют темп, нагрузку и стабильность

Производительность программного обеспечения тестируется через систему стрессовых проверок, которые имитируют различные варианты эксплуатации программы в действительных ситуациях. Стрессовое проверка выявляет, как приложение функционирует при ожидаемом количестве клиентов и действий.

Экстремальное испытание способствует найти момент сбоя системы, планомерно увеличивая нагрузку до максимальных значений. Это обеспечивает понять пределы потенциала приложения и тестировать, как адекватно она деградирует при перегрузке.

Контроль надежности охватывает длительные проверки функционирования программы Драгон мани под постоянной нагрузкой для обнаружения расхода памяти, планомерного падения производительности и других неполадок, которые демонстрируются только при продолжительной работе.

Отслеживание быстродействия во время контроля содержит наблюдение использования процессора, оперативной памяти, хранилища и сетевых средств. Эти показатели способствуют найти узкие места в архитектуре и улучшить быстродействие приложения.

Что делают, если ошибка выявлена перед релизом

Обнаружение бага перед релизом решения инициирует процесс изучения критичности проблемы и формирования выбора о последующих шагах. Критические ошибки, которые могут повлечь к утрате информации, компрометации защиты или тотальной неработоспособности программы, нуждаются немедленного исправления.

Методология регулирования ошибками включает детальное оформление обнаруженной неполадки с обозначением этапов для воспроизведения, среды, в где выражается баг, и предполагаемого поведения системы. Отдел создания исследует ошибку, выявляет источник и планирует устранение.

Ранжирование коррекций строится на эффекте бага на клиентов Драгон мани казино, частоте ее проявления и комплексности устранения. Отдельные незначительные проблемы могут быть перенаправлены до следующего выпуска, если их устранение предполагает существенных модификаций в программе.

После устранения дефекта выполняется подтверждающее тестирование, которое подтверждает, что неполадка ликвидирована, а также регрессионное тестирование для проверки того, что коррекция не привело к появлению новых ошибок в других элементах приложения.